
According to the report, Ant-Man and the Wasp: Quantum Mania has earned over $100 million at the US box office and over $220 million worldwide in its first three days. It is the first Marvel film to hit theaters since November’s Black Panther: Wakanda Forever.
The 31st film of Marvel Studios was eagerly awaited by the fans but the critics called it a flop before its release. Some called it marginally better than the worst Marvel movie ever, ‘Eternals’, while others called it the worst movie of the year. Despite the bad reviews, critics believe that the success of this movie is due to other filmmakers. The film has earned double the opening weekend business of the first Ant-Man film and is the 31st consecutive Marvel film to debut at the top position at the box office.
